It activates at about room temperature.

It gives off gas at 78 degrees F (about 25.6 degrees C). That is one of the reasons why the SS packed victims tightly into the gas chambers. They wanted to get the temperature up to that level quickly from the heat of the human bodies inside.

Is zyklon b gas or solid?

Zyklon B is/was supplied in solid form but releases toxic hydrocyanic gas at above 25.5 degrees C (= 78F). If dropped into a sealed room with human beings tightly packed together it soon releases the gas.
